Gear for this water
For the trout (rainbow trout on the season program here)
| Light spinning rod | 5 to 6.5 ft light or ultralight; short rods cast under branches |
| Inline spinners | 1/16 to 1/8 oz silver or gold; swing them across the current seams |
| Drifted bait | single salmon egg or half a crawler under light split shot, rolled along the bottom |
